
cajun french onion broccoli jambalaya
February 4, 2013this came out of a craving for broccoli cheese soup, french onion soup, and jambalaya. it’s all of them at the same time. easy to make vegetarian, too – just leave out the sausage and chicken, and replace with whatever veggies you have in the house that taste great in soup!
+
fry two onions in a soup pot.
add stock, or water and bouillon.
add a head of peeled roasted garlic, two bay leaves, and a hot chili pepper or two. (i added potatoes, too, since i have a surplus.)
boil together a half-hour or so until soup base tastes wonderful.
add cajun seasoning blend (make your own with thyme, oregano, paprika, cayenne, onion and garlic, salt and pepper,) cut-up raw chicken, chunked broccoli stems, and slices of andouille sausage.
cook about another half-hour.
add broccoli florets 3 – 5 minutes before soup is done.
top with a little cheddar.
